♈ Rashi (Zodiac Sign) of Rajeswari

The Rashi (Vedic moon sign) associated with the name Rajeswari is Tula. Tula (Libra) — ruled by Venus, associated with balance, fairness, and artistry.

In Indian astrology, the Rashi is determined by the first syllable of the name and plays an important role in a child's horoscope. Parents often choose a name that matches the Rashi recommended by a family astrologer at the time of birth. Rajeswari, falling under Tula, is considered an auspicious name for a girl born under this sign.

⭐ Nakshatra of Rajeswari

The Nakshatra (lunar mansion) associated with the name Rajeswari is Chitra. Chitra Nakshatra is ruled by Mars and represents artistry, brilliance, and architectural skill.

Nakshatras are the 27 lunar mansions used in Vedic astrology to understand personality, karma, and life purpose. A child born under Chitra Nakshatra may carry these inherent qualities through life. Choosing the name Rajeswari, which is aligned with this Nakshatra, is believed to harmonise the child's energy with her birth star.
